If you live in Cook County, are your property taxes too high? Cook County has the largest population in the State of Illinois and includes the City of Chicago. Until recently, it has been difficult to determine your home's value based on it's tax assessed value.
Cook County tax assessments on residental properties reflect 10% of market value. When the assessor values a home at $250,000, then your assessed value would be 25,000.
